The most popular kinds of obstacle avoidance technology found in robots are ultrasonic, light, and camera sensors. Ultrasonic sensors emit high-frequency sound waves that can detect objects and other objects in the room. They can also be used to detect height changes like the edges of stairs or carpets. Certain DEEBOT robots use this sensor to boost suction power while navigating stairs and other challenging areas.

Other robots employ a sophisticated obstacle avoidance technique called simultaneous mapping and localization (SLAM). These robots employ laser sensors to create an accurate map of their surroundings. They also detect obstacles based on their dimensions and shape. SLAM technology is commonly utilized by robot vacuums to navigate around furniture and other big obstacles.

2. Self-emptying dust bin

If you're a busy person a self-emptying robot vacuum bot is your ideal dream to come to life. These models automatically empty the collection bins within the docking station. This makes it unnecessary to empty the bins manually onboard between cleaning sessions. It's a major time saver, and is a fantastic option for people suffering from household allergies. It also prevents dust particles from being released back into the air upon emptying, so you don't have to worry about it triggering your symptoms in the future.

3. Room-specific cleaning

Robotic cleaners can understand the layout of your home with the combination of sensors as well as mapping capabilities and smart algorithms. By creating an image of the room, robot cleaners can move furniture and other items more efficiently and precisely. This is particularly beneficial in multi-floored homes. Some robots have wall sensors that allow them to navigate through open doors and clean new rooms.

Modern mopbots and robotic vacuums have the ability to map, however each manufacturer has its own unique way of implementing this feature. LiDAR, vSLAM, and other mapping technologies help the robot navigate through your home. Each space is divided into segments, which are then cleaned in straight lines.

These technologies can also recognize certain areas of your home that might require more attention, for instance, under chairs and tables where dirt accumulates. 4. Scheduled cleaning

Many robot cleaners can be capable of mopping and vacuuming several times a week to remove dust, food crumbs, and pet hair. The owners report that their homes feel cleaner and fresher than before. However, this kind of frequency can strain batteries and wear out sensors and brushes faster. Follow the manufacturer's instructions on charging and emptying your robot in order to prolong its lifespan. Keep a container filled with compressed air ready to blow dust away from sensors, gears and nooks that are difficult to reach from the base. Replace filters, side brushes and brush rolls in accordance with the directions.
